Christmas season events in Catonsville

The 18th annual Catonsville Tree Lighting and visit from Santa Claus on Nov. 26 marked the official start of the holiday season in Catonsville. The Greater Catonsville Chamber of Commerce's Santa House at 756 Frederick Road is open Fridays, 6-8 p.m. and Saturdays, 2-4 p.m. Special Sunday hours 2-5 p.m. on Dec. 18. Breakfast with Santa — Dec. 3, 9 a.m.-noon. Adults $6, children 3-10 $4.Children younger than 3 free. Hosted by Trinity United Methodist Church, 2100 Westchester Ave. http://www.trinitycatonsville.com or 410-747-5841.

Christmas tea with senior choir — Dec. 3, noon-2 p.m. Refreshments and music. Guests encouraged to wear Christmas colors. Hosted by Grace A.M.E. Church, 67 Winters Lane. 410-744-9478 or graceadm@verizon.net.

Santa Stumble — held along Frederick Road Dec. 3, 5-6 p.m. Check-In at Sea Hut Inn, 727 Frederick Road. $20 registration fee includes long sleeve T-shirt, Santa hat and wrist band entitling participants to discounts and specials at various businesses along Frederick Road. Hosted by Catonsville High School alums to benefit Comet Park Renovation Project at Catonsville High. Sue Plitt, 410-615-8897, 443-690-3433 or http://www.touchingliveswithcomfort.org.

Holiday music — performed by Maryland Youth Symphony Orchestra Dec. 4, 3 p.m., at CCBC Catonsville, 800 S. Rolling Road, Fine and Performing Arts Theatre. $15 general, $10 seniors and students. http://www.myso.info.

Holiday music — performed by Handel Choir of Baltimore Dec. 4, 7 p.m. at Our Lady of the Angels Chapel, Charlestown retirement community, 711 Maiden Choice Lane, Catonsville. Free. 410-737-0669.

Holiday harmonica — music by Ed Katz, Dec. 6, 12:45 p.m. at Catonsville Senior Center, 501 N. Rolling Road, Catonsville, 410-887-0900.

Holiday bazaar and Christmas Service Project — at Mount St. Joseph High School, 4403 Frederick Ave., Dec. 6, 6-9 p.m. Holiday gifts provided by Mt. St. Joe women-owned businesses, 6-8:30 p.m. Then create gifts for U.S. troops abroad, My Brother's Keeper and other local charitable organizations, 7:30-9 p.m. Light refreshments, give-a-ways and holiday cheer. http://www.msjnet.edu.

Christmas cantata "Agnus Dei" — presented by The Alleluias and featuring the music of Michael W. Smith, Dec. 6, 7:30 p.m. in Our Lady of the Angels Chapel, Charlestown Retirement Community, 715 Maiden Choice Lane, Catonsville, Free. However, a love offering will be taken to further the ministry of the choir. 443-812-1037.

Photographing Christmas and Hanukkah in Baltimore — Dec. 8, 12:45 p.m. at Catonsville Senior Center, 501 N. Rolling Road, Catonsville, 410-887-0900.

Journey to Bethlehem — at Christian Temple, 5820 Edmondson Ave., Catonsville, Dec. 10, 6-8 p.m.,. Live drama of the events leading up to the birth of Jesus Christ. Journeys begin at 6 p.m. and leave every 15 minutes until 8 p.m. Free. 410-747-2041or http://www.christiantemple.org.

See "Christmas Celebration" — bus trip to Evangel Cathedral in Upper Marlboro sponsored by Joint Usher Board of Grace A.M.E. Church. Dec. 10, 10:30 a.m.-6 p.m. $85. Sandy Arnette, 410-274-5975.
